## FAQ: What happens if the formula sandbox wedges during an incident?

The Calqa formula engine runs user-supplied expressions in an isolated interpreter with strict CPU and memory budgets. If the sandbox supervisor wedges, paging goes to on-call automatically. Do not restart the host; drain the evaluation queue first, then restart only the supervisor process. If the supervisor's service account is locked out after the restart, the recovery console will request the passphrase shown below.

unlock words, fafop-hawep: briwyn-oliix-sorox

- [ ] Step 7: Archive cold storage buckets (Glacierline tier). Confirm both ceremony witnesses are present, verify bucket manifests match the Oxbow ledger, then seal the archive key shares. Plugin authors may observe but not handle shares. Once sealed, the archive index itself is encrypted and can only be reopened with the passphrase below.

vault phrase of badup-hahig = tamael-aldael-kelmir-istael-fenok-istwyn-tamius-jorath-oliion

## Deploying the Gatewick Proctor Queue

Deploys are pretty painless: push to main, wait for the pipeline, then watch the queue drain dashboard for five minutes. If candidates pile up mid-exam, roll back first and ask questions later — the queue replays safely. Everything the workers care about lives in one config block, shown here for reference.

settings of bafof-yagef:
JOROX_PIN=8740
JOROX_TENANT=pelox
JOROX_METRICS_HOST=metrics.jorox.qorvelworks.internal
JOROX_SEAL=seal_c78f63c1
JOROX_STANDBY_TEAM=norax